Artificial intelligence is no longer restricted by a shortage of graphics processing units. Today, electrical grids have become the primary bottleneck for the industry. You can see this shift clearly with Dominion Energy, which is currently facing roughly 70GW in pending large-load interconnection requests, despite its all-time peak demand reaching only 24GW. Because the sector is now bound by power availability rather than hardware, companies must route their workloads directly to where the electricity already exists.
